After a long weekend and a bunch of troubleshooting I finally got all 4 cylinders. It turned out that the Ford spark plug boots were not making good contact on the plugs so I was getting a weak spark. Along with the rich mixture the plugs got fouled.
Aside from feeling like an idiot I'm pumped.

I'm going to have to look at the plug wires. Either they were not on far enough and arcing to the electrode or they were on to far and shorting against the base of the plug. Next time I get to jung yard I'll pull a plug out of an Escort and see whats up.
